Transaction 68880eaed74ca9fa4fdeafacd3013f97cfadb5385a81324fa5e470de8b2bfeb3

block
6825f21cae49b934209b4ba368d93aadaa0080bdec5b11f3e69d9f345f72ecfd

1 Input

11 Outputs